Three students at Lakehead University each received a $3,000 scholarship
Through its MROO Scholarship Program, MROO has awarded $134,000 in student scholarships distributed to 44 exceptional students across the province. The scholarships will support recipients in their post-secondary studies.
MROO is divided into 9 Zones across Ontario with Zone Directors responsible for each region. Scholarships are awarded in each Zone. Recipients were determined based on the number of applicants and specific eligibility criteria, including the student’s leadership skills, volunteer experience, and commitment to making a difference in their communities. From Zone 8 – which includes Thunder Bay – 3 students were awarded $3,000 each to assist with their studies.
“I am so proud to be a part of MROO and see the excellent work we are doing in our local communities. The MROO Scholarship program continues to help our future leaders reach their academic and career goals. Congratulations to our students in Zone 8, and best of luck this year!” says Bill Latham, Director of Zone 8.
Since 2006, MROO has awarded annual scholarships to Canadian students. This year these scholarships are valued at $3,000 each. The MROO Scholarships are awarded annually to family members of current MROO members. "These young students were chosen based on their academic achievements and efforts to give back to their communities " said Keith Robicheau President of MROO. "MROO’s mission is to support our members and their families and improve the lives of all Canadians.
The MROO Scholarship program aligns with MROO’s core mission to support current MROO members and their families and help the next generation to succeed and give back to their communities. These scholarships represent the importance MROO places on education and investing in the next generation of leaders.
